As a member of the Equipment Engineering staff, the Wafer Fab Equipment Engineer will have ownership of one or more tool sets within a wafer fab manufacturing operation. Equipment Engineers are responsible for the overall availability and performance of their assigned equipment sets in accordance with SEMI E10.

Responsibilities will include:

  • Design and implement maintenance programs to improve tool availability and reduce cost of ownership;
  • Analyze equipment performance metrics (MTBF, uptime, MTTR, etc.) to determine areas for improvement;   
  • Write PM procedures, checklists, troubleshooting guides, and work instructions for your assigned equipment set;
  • Evaluate and recommend the selection of new process equipment;
  • Plan, manage and execute all assigned equipment installations or upgrades to the Fab or manufacturing equipment;
  • Continuous improvement of reliability, availability, yield and quality as well as cost and scrap reduction support;
  • Assists equipment maintenance technicians in the troubleshooting of critical down tools;
  • Establish and maintain spare part Bill of Materials (BOMs) for assigned equipment.

Requirements:

  • 5+ years of Equipment Engineering experience is preferred;
  • Solid background working as a sustaining equipment engineer in a 24/7 manufacturing environment;
  • Proven track record of systematically improving MTBF and tool availability by implementing root cause corrective actions;
  • Ability to generate necessary equipment documentation for an equipment maintenance organization;
  • Strong project leadership, organization and excellent communication skills;
  • Basic understanding of safety, health and environmental area;
  • Technically strong in electrical, mechanical, and can lead troubleshooting of down time of equipment;
  • Ability to provide the highest level of in-house support for tool down situations;
  • Manage new tool installations, modifications and upgrades to existing tools;
  • Strong computer skills to include Word, Excel, and Project.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
